Gel Insoles: Your Feet’s Best Friend
Why Gel Insoles?
Do your feet hurt after a long day? Do your shoes feel stiff and unsupportive? Gel insoles can be a game-changer! They add extra cushioning and shock absorption to your favorite shoes, making walking, running, and standing much more comfortable. Think of them as a plush mattress for your feet!
Key Features to Look For
- Cushioning Level: Some insoles offer soft, pillowy cushioning, while others provide firmer support. Consider what feels best for your feet.
- Arch Support: If you have flat feet or high arches, look for insoles with built-in arch support. This helps keep your foot in a neutral position.
- Shock Absorption: Gel is excellent at absorbing impact. This is great for activities like running or jumping, which put a lot of stress on your feet.
- Breathability: Some insoles have special designs or materials that allow air to circulate, keeping your feet cool and dry.
- Durability: You want insoles that will last. Look for well-made products that don’t flatten out quickly.
Important Materials
Gel insoles are primarily made from a special type of gel. This gel can be:
- Thermoplastic Polyurethane (TPU): This is a common and durable gel material. It offers good cushioning and support.
- Silicone: Silicone gel is often softer and more flexible. It can provide a very plush feel.
- Other Foams: Many insoles combine gel with other cushioning foams, like EVA (ethylene-vinyl acetate), for added comfort and support.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
What makes a gel insole good?
- Gel Density: A slightly denser gel often provides better support and lasts longer.
- Even Gel Distribution: The gel should be spread evenly throughout the insole for consistent cushioning.
- Durable Top Layer: The material covering the gel is important. A fabric that wicks away moisture and is resistant to wear will improve the insole’s lifespan.
What can make a gel insole not so good?
- Too Soft or Too Firm Gel: If the gel is too soft, it might flatten out quickly and offer little support. If it’s too firm, it might not provide enough cushioning.
- Uneven Gel: Patches of gel can lead to uncomfortable pressure points.
- Poorly Stitched or Thin Top Layer: This can wear out quickly and make the insole less comfortable.

Frequently Asked Questions about Gel Insoles
Q: How do I know if I need gel insoles?
A: If your feet hurt, feel tired, or lack cushioning in your shoes, gel insoles might help. You can also tell if you have specific foot issues like arch pain.
Q: Can gel insoles help with plantar fasciitis?
A: Yes, many people with plantar fasciitis find that gel insoles with good arch support and cushioning can provide relief.
Q: How long do gel insoles usually last?
A: This can vary, but many good quality gel insoles can last anywhere from 6 months to a year or more with regular use.
Q: Can I put gel insoles in any type of shoe?
A: Generally, yes! They work well in sneakers, boots, dress shoes, and even some sandals, as long as there’s enough room in the shoe.
Q: How do I clean gel insoles?
A: Most gel insoles can be cleaned with mild soap and water. Let them air dry completely before putting them back in your shoes.
Q: Will gel insoles make my shoes tighter?
A: They can add a little thickness, so if your shoes are already a tight fit, they might feel a bit snugger.
Q: What’s the difference between gel and foam insoles?
A: Gel insoles are often better at absorbing shock and can be more durable. Foam insoles can be lighter and offer a softer initial feel.
Q: Do I need to break in gel insoles?
A: Usually, no. Gel insoles are designed to be comfortable right out of the box.
Q: Can I cut gel insoles to fit my shoes?
A: Some insoles are designed to be cut. Check the product packaging to see if this is an option.
Q: Are gel insoles good for running?
A: Yes, many runners use gel insoles for the extra cushioning and shock absorption they provide.
